Post Point, Park County, Wyoming

Post Point is a physical feature (summit) in Park County. The primary coordinates for Post Point places it within the 82414 ZIP Code delivery area.

Feature Name: Post Point
Category: Wyoming physical, cultural and historic features
Feature Type: Physical
Class: Summit
Description: In the Absaroka Range, on the NW slope of Clayton Mountain, 56 km (35 mi) WSW of Cody.
History: Named by theU.S. Forest Service (USFS)in 1984 for Urban J. Post (?-1982),U.S. Forest Service (USFS)District Ranger, who with other fire fighters under his command, took refuge on this point during the Blackwater Fire in August of 1937.
County: Park County
Latitude: 44.413336
Longitude: -109.7327187
